- [ ] Step 7: Archive cold storage buckets (Glacierline tier). Confirm both ceremony witnesses are present, verify bucket manifests match the Oxbow ledger, then seal the archive key shares. Plugin authors may observe but not handle shares. Once sealed, the archive index itself is encrypted and can only be reopened with the passphrase below.

vault phrase of badup-hahig = tamael-aldael-kelmir-istael-fenok-istwyn-tamius-jorath-oliion

- [ ] Verify the Lanegrove queue-depth autoscaler respects the new floor of two workers during drain. Scale-up latency must stay under 30s at 5x synthetic load; see the harness in tools/qsim. Confirm metrics emit under the renamed prefix before merge. The canary build that passed these checks is identified below.

pipeline stamp: htk9_ce63042d9

### Checklist: WebSocket compression (Relaymote 2.9)

Verify permessage-deflate stays OFF for the trading feed and ON for chat. Compression saves ~60% bandwidth on chat but adds latency spikes and memory per connection — unacceptable on the feed. Do not flip defaults in config; they are per-channel. Run the soak test on the Hollowpine staging cluster for 30 minutes, confirm RSS stays under the documented ceiling, and record results in the release doc. Confirm the artifact you tested matches the token below.

session token of fahap-hawip = htk31_7852f2b3276dba2738f98fa97f92237